With nearly 35,000 team members, Global Medical Response teams deliver compassionate, quality medical care, primarily in the areas of emergency and patient relocation services in the United States, including the District of Columbia and around the world. GMR was formed by combining the industry leaders in air and ground emergency medical services. Each of our companies have long histories of proudly serving the communities where we live: American Medical Response (AMR), Air Evac Lifeteam, REACH Air Medical Services, Med-Trans Corporation, AirMed International and Guardian Flight.

  • For more than 32 years, Vicky Spediacci has dedicated her life to saving others, showing how passion and perseverance can create a lasting impact. Beginning her career as REACH Air Medical Services’ first female helicopter line pilot in 1994, Vicky broke barriers and paved the way for others to follow. Today, as vice president and air chief operating officer, she continues to inspire with her leadership and dedication to the air medical industry. Vicky’s career has been a journey of growth and purpose. From flying critical missions to mentoring future leaders, she has taken on roles including chief pilot, director of flight operations, and vice president of aviation operations. Her commitment to education and safety has shaped an environment where excellence and innovation thrive. For those interested in pursuing a career in EMS, Vicky’s advice is to follow their passion with determination. She believes that anyone with a commitment to serving others can find success in this field. Vicky’s story is a powerful reminder that EMS is more than a profession; it is a calling to lead, serve, and make a meaningful difference. Her industrious career began at age 20 while living in Minnesota where she performed maintenance on agriculture Bell 47 helicopters. It was that initial passion that propelled her towards Air EMS life, and for 3 years now, Kalyn has been a dedicated aircraft maintenance technician working with Air Evac Lifeteam.
